Transaction 26951178027af74da73c0ed3b15ec373082c32fb54c368f78acc39581d87f142
1 Input
2 Outputs
- 26951178027af74da73c0ed3b15ec373082c32fb54c368f78acc39581d87f142:0
- 26951178027af74da73c0ed3b15ec373082c32fb54c368f78acc39581d87f142:1
value 111458
address 377mJBr5kaM5BHSuhL4KmfTAsecmZNptX5
value 1708840
address 1KHEhqVbZjMwHcepW4rwANFjW1qbZjVhVz